Title :
The Performance of a Two-Stage BAF Treating Mature Landfill Leachate with Different Carbon Source and HRT

Abstract :
Mature landfill leachate, containing high concentration of nitrogen, and low ratio of C/N, is difficult for biological treatment .In this paper, the leachate treatment of Jiangmen Landfill Site was studied. There is new requirement of the Standard for Pollution Control on the Landfill Site (GB16889-2008) of effluent TN concentration, after the processes of "SBR-Fenton-BAF". Two-stage BAF was carried out in the pilot plant study to improve the old treatment processes. The influent of this pilot was the effluent of Fenton process with TN concentration was 120~200 mg · L-1. The efficiency of various carbon source for nitrogen removal was of the following order: methanol>; glucose>;sucrose. By the conditions of influent added with methanol as external carbon source and HRT was 7h, TN concentration of the effluent was less than 40 mg · L-1, reach to the new discharge standards after treatment.
